1.
概述与测试目标
测试背景:针对面向韩国及东亚用户的网站做稳定性评估。
测试目标:验证速驰韩国 CN2 云主机在高并发访问下的可用性与性能上限。
覆盖维度:响应时延、成功率、95% 响应时间、CPU/内存与带宽占用。
对比项:直连主机 vs 加速 CDN + 基础 DDoS 防护的表现差异。
预期结果:给出实测数据与优化建议,提供生产部署参考。
2.
测试环境与主机配置(示例)
主机示例 A:速驰韩国 CN2 VPS(测试主机),配置:4 vCPU(Intel Xeon 2.4GHz)、8GB RAM、NVMe 80GB。
网络:韩国本地出网,CN2 专线回国链路,默认带宽最大 1Gbps(峰值可突发至 5Gbps)。
防护与加速:云盾基础 DDoS 防护(包周期流量异常清洗)、选配 CDN(节点覆盖首尔、东京、香港)。
域名解析:测试以 example-kr.test 为示例,使用国内 DNS 与韩国本地解析对比。
测试机(压力机):上海机房 k6 + wrk2 混合,分布式 3 台,共计 500 个并发线程用于并发模拟。
3.
压测工具与方法
工具组合:wrk2(稳定 TPS)、k6(脚本化场景)、ab(简单对比)。
场景设计:静态页面(50KB)与动态接口(JSON,200ms 后端处理)两类流量。
并发级别:100、500、1000、3000、5000 并发分别测试 5 分钟。
监控指标:平均响应、p95、错误率、CPU 峰值、带宽峰值、连接数。
重复验证:每组测试至少跑 3 次取中位数,记录异常日志与抓包样本用于分析。
4.
关键性能数据(实测结果)
下面表格为静态页面并发测试的核心数据(主机直连、未启用 CDN):
| 并发数 | 总请求数(5min) | 成功率 | 平均响应(ms) | p95(ms) | CPU 峰值(%) | 带宽峰值(Mbps) |
| 100 | 300,000 | 99.99% | 22 | 45 | 18% | 18 |
| 500 | 1,500,000 | 99.95% | 48 | 110 | 46% | 82 |
| 1000 | 3,000,000 | 99.60% | 95 | 220 | 78% | 160 |
| 3000 | 9,000,000 | 95.20% | 320 | 820 | 98% | 420 |
| 5000 | 15,000,000 | 88.70% | 780 | 2,200 | CPU 限制 | >680 |
附注:动态接口测试在 1000 并发时平均响应上升约 1.6 倍,错误率增加 0.8%。
5.
稳定性分析与真实故障案例
观察到的瓶颈:CPU 达到 90% 以上时,平均响应显著抬升且出现连接超时。
网络瓶颈:带宽在 3000 并发后接近实例带宽上限,抖动与丢包几率增加。
真实案例:某电商促销测试中,直连主机在 3200 并发时出现 30 分钟断流,SYSLOG 显示大量 TCP 建立/关闭,疑似文件描述符耗尽。
启用 CDN 后复测:相同并发下成功率从 95.2% 提升至 99.7%,p95 从 820ms 降到 120ms。
DDoS 防护效果:在模拟小流量攻击(每秒 200k 包)时,云盾自动清洗后对正常请求影响 < 5%。
6.
优化建议与结论
短期优化:增加带宽包或水平扩容到 2 台负载均衡主机以分摊并发流量。
软件优化:使用 keepalive、Gzip、静态资源缓存与 Nginx 缓存配置减少后端压力。
加速与防护:强烈建议接入 CDN 并启用云端 DDoS 清洗策略以保证峰值活动稳定。
监控策略:建议部署 Prometheus + Grafana 监控 CPU/CONN/BANDWIDTH/FD,并设置告警阈值。
结论:速驰韩国 CN2 云主机在中等并发(<=1000)下表现良好;面对超大并发应结合 CDN、负载均衡与弹性扩容以保证稳定性。